    To visit, like come here for a few weeks and go home ? Just a Visa, they will apply at the US embassy in Mexico.

    If they want to marry or work, it takes other visas

    If you are talking about a visit, your relative must apply for B1/B2 visa (tourist visa/visitor's visa) at US embassy.

    She may or may not be eligible for immigrant visa... depends on relationship with you.
